Balcony Waterproofing in Renton, WA
Balcony waterproofing services involve applying specialized sealants and membranes to protect balcony surfaces from water intrusion and damage. This service is essential for maintaining the integrity of balconies, especially in areas with frequent rain or moisture exposure. Projects typically include waterproofing existing balconies, as well as new construction or renovation projects where preventing water leaks and seepage is a priority. Property owners often want to understand the types of waterproofing materials used, the longevity of the protection, and how the process can help prevent issues like mold, wood rot, or structural deterioration.
Before requesting balcony waterproofing, property owners should consider the current condition of the balcony surface, including any signs of water damage or cracks. It is also helpful to understand the scope of work needed, whether it involves surface preparation, drainage improvements, or complete membrane installation. Clear communication about the existing balcony structure and any previous repairs can ensure the waterproofing solution is effective and long-lasting. Proper waterproofing can extend the lifespan of a balcony while maintaining its safety and appearance.

Balcony Waterproofing Questions
What is balcony waterproofing? It involves applying protective materials to prevent water from penetrating balcony surfaces, helping to avoid damage and leaks.
Which types of balconies benefit from waterproofing? Both new constructions and existing balconies can benefit, especially those exposed to frequent weather changes or visible water issues.
How does waterproofing protect a balcony? It creates a barrier that prevents water infiltration, reducing the risk of structural damage and mold growth.
What are common signs that balcony waterproofing is needed? Visible water stains, pooling water, or spongy surfaces are indicators that waterproofing may be necessary.
